Shingle repair services involve the assessment, replacement, and restoration of damaged or deteriorated roofing shingles. Professionals evaluate the condition of existing shingles to identify issues such as cracks, curling, missing pieces, or granule loss. Repair work may include patching small sections, sealing leaks, or replacing individual shingles to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ance. Proper repair ensures the roof maintains its protective barrier against weather elements, preventing further damage and prolonging its lifespan.

These services address common roofing problems like leaks, water intrusion, shingle blow-offs, and storm-related damage. Damaged shingles can compromise the roof’s ability to keep out moisture, leading to potential structural issues and interior water damage. Repairing shingles promptly can help prevent more extensive repairs down the line, such as replacing entire roof sections or addressing mold and rot caused by prolonged exposure to moisture.

Material Costs - The cost of shingle materials typically ranges from $100 to $400 per square (100 square feet), depending on the type and quality of shingles selected. Higher-end materials, such as architectural or designer shingles, tend to be more expensive.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for shingle repair services usually fall between $150 and $300 per square, varying with project complexity and local labor rates. Additional charges may apply for extensive repairs or difficult access areas. Contractors can assess the scope to provide accurate estimates.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of old shingles, disposal fees, or repairs to underlying roof structures, which can add $50 to $200 per square. These charges depend on the extent of damage and the specific requirements of the repair project. Local service providers can clarify potential additional expenses.

Total Cost Range - Overall, shingle repair services typically cost between $300 and $900 per square, combining materials, labor, and additional fees. How do I know if my shingles need repair? Signs such as missing, cracked, or curling shingles, water stains on ceilings, or increased energy bills may indicate the need for shingle repair services.

What causes shingles to become damaged? Common causes include severe weather, wind, hail, falling debris, or aging materials that weaken shingles over time.

How long does shingle rep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a day by local service providers.

Are shingle repairs covered by warranty? Warranty coverage depends on the manufacturer and the contractor; it’s best to consult with local pros about specific warranty details.

How can I prevent future shingle damage? Regular inspections, prompt repairs, and clearing debris from the roof can help maintain shingle integrity and prevent damage.
